Wojciech Rogoziński

3×3 Fewest Moves · top 0.17% of 12,294 all-time · competing since August 2019 · 2019ROGO04

Wojciech Rogoziński has been competing for 7 years. His best event is the 3×3 Fewest Moves: a personal-best single of 18 moves, set at Europe FMC Friends - Winter 2025, puts him in the top 0.17% of the 12,294 people who have ever been ranked in the event, and 2nd in Poland. Across 113 competitions since August 2019, he has put 2,623 official solves on the record across 16 events. Solve to solve, his 3×3 times vary about 13% around a typical one, steadier than 56% of the 35,811 competitors with ten or more counted rounds. His 3×3 best has come down from 16.21 in August 2019 to 7.58, a 53% improvement. Wojciech has entered 113 competitions, more competitions than 99% of everyone who has ever competed.

Reading this page: a single is one solve's time · an average is the middle three of five solves, best and worst discarded · a PB is a personal best · a DNF (did not finish) is an attempt with no valid result: a popped piece, an unsolved face, an over-limit memorisation · top X% compares against everyone ever ranked in that event, which is fairer than raw rank because event pools differ tenfold.
